What is a FIFO cleaner?

FIFO Cleaners are cleaning professionals who work on a Fly-In Fly-Out (FIFO) basis, typically servicing remote or regional locations such as mining sites, oil and gas facilities, or construction camps. They travel to the worksite for a set roster period, often staying in provided accommodation, before flying back home during their off-shift. Their duties include maintaining cleanliness and hygiene in accommodation blocks, common areas, kitchens, and amenities to ensure a safe and comfortable environment for all site personnel. FIFO Cleaners must adhere to strict safety and hygiene standards, and the role often requires adaptability to challenging and changing environments.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a FIFO cleaner?

To thrive as a FIFO Cleaner, you need a solid understanding of cleaning protocols, attention to detail, and often a White Card or similar safety certification. Familiarity with commercial cleaning equipment, chemical handling procedures, and compliance with safety management systems is typically required. Strong time management, reliability, and effective communication skills help ensure smooth operations in remote environments. These competencies are essential for maintaining high hygiene standards and ensuring the safety and comfort of workers in FIFO (Fly-In Fly-Out) sites.

What are some common challenges FIFO cleaners face when working on remote sites?

FIFO Cleaners often work in remote or isolated locations, which can present challenges such as adjusting to a rostered schedule (e.g., two weeks on, one week off) and managing the physical demands of cleaning large facilities. Additionally, adapting to shared living spaces, limited amenities, and long periods away from family can be difficult. However, most teams foster a supportive environment, and strong communication with supervisors helps address issues as they arise. Being proactive about self-care and maintaining work-life balance is key to thriving in this role.
